Output 304fa8159e796d7f7645558b44fd9522f18c747eab79f771677a56f15f5267d2:20

value
3254716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ab129140fb60610676283254b2ac80744e3f76 OP_EQUAL
address
3NMXaE1YqX5DSQcJfLgtw3yNCqP799g3rz
transaction
304fa8159e796d7f7645558b44fd9522f18c747eab79f771677a56f15f5267d2
spent
true